Resumo: This work had as its theme the implantation of a suspended school garden in a kindergarten school, aiming to demonstrate that the student of any age group, can be stimulated beneficially through pedagogical practices. The method used in this work is a case study that allowed the investigation and analysis of the whole process during the experiences experienced in the development of the garden. The aim of the project was to provide learning through the planting and cultivation of vegetables, seeking the adoption of healthy habits, involving students with the school environment and its team, as well as providing sustainability concepts using the reuse of materials such as PET bottles, even in the face of challenges such as lack of space and structure in the institution. According to the research carried out with parents / guardians and with teachers, represented by graphs, we find through data collected, great benefits. We observed the students 'food preferences and which vegetables they did not have the habit of ingesting, allowing a greater variety in the offer, besides analyzing the parents / guardians and teachers' view on the implementation of the suspended school garden, what initiatives the children had already been involved in the family and school environment and to verify what activities the students identified most during the process. The benefits achieved by the implementation of the suspended school garden are great, since it becomes effective in the search for healthier habits and in the reutilization of materials as didactic resource. Still, we emphasize that the suspended garden was an efficient alternative for the exploration of the existing physical space.
